智能机器人作为一种能够模仿人类智能行为的机器设备,其编程语言的选择对于其功能的实现和性能的优化至关重要。在智能机器人编程领域,有多种编程语言可供选择,每种语言都有其特定的优势和适用场景。本文将通过定义、分类、举例和比较等方法来阐述智能机器人用什么语言编程的相关知识。
第五部分:SCRATCH智能机器人的未来发展方向
智能机器人编程语言的选择是根据具体的需求和场景来确定的。不同类型的编程语言具有各自的优势和适用范围,开发人员应根据项目的要求和自身的技能来选择合适的编程语言。随着人工智能和机器学习等领域的不断发展,智能机器人编程语言的选择也将不断演进和完善。通过不断学习和探索,我们可以更好地应用适合的编程语言来开发智能机器人,为人类生活和工作带来更多的便利和创新。
结尾:
智能机器人作为一项具有巨大潜力的技术,将会在未来得到更多的关注和应用。从工业领域到医疗领域,从家庭生活到社会服务,智能机器人都将发挥重要角色。我们期待着智能机器人技术的突破和创新,为人类带来更美好的未来。
四、智能机器人在家庭生活中的应用
智能机器人在工业领域的应用已经日益广泛。它们可以代替人力完成重复性、高强度的工作任务,提高工作效率和质量。在汽车制造领域,智能机器人可以精确地进行焊接、喷涂等工作,避免了人为因素导致的差错。在物流领域,智能机器人可以自动化地执行搬运、分拣等工作,大大缩短了作业时间,降低了劳动力成本。
三、智能机器人在医疗领域的应用
智能机器人用什么语言编程
引言:
一、智能机器人的发展现状
随着技术的不断创新和教育的不断变革,SCRATCH智能机器人的未来发展方向主要包括以下几个方面。对于硬件的创新和改进,如提高机器人的智能化程度、增加更多的传感器和功能等。对于软件的创新和优化,如开发更多的教学资源和编程案例、提供更个性化的学习路径等。还可以加强与其他学科的融合,如与数学、物理、艺术等学科的结合,开发更多的跨学科教学内容。
SCRATCH智能机器人在教育领域有着广泛的应用。它可以作为一种创新的教学工具,帮助学生们更好地理解编程概念和科学原理,提高他们的逻辑思维和问题解决能力。SCRATCH智能机器人还可以用于科技竞赛和课外活动,激发孩子们对科学技术的兴趣,培养他们的团队合作和创新能力。
脚本语言是一种简单易用的编程语言,常用于快速原型开发和自动化任务。在智能机器人编程中,脚本语言可以提供快速开发和灵活性。常见的脚本语言包括Lua和Shell等。Lua语言是一种轻量级的脚本语言,适用于嵌入式系统和资源受限的环境下,具有高性能和灵活性的特点。
六、结语
声明式编程语言是一种通过描述问题的逻辑关系来实现编程的方法。与命令式编程语言相比,声明式编程语言更加关注问题的本质和解决方案的描述,而不是具体的实现细节。常见的声明式编程语言有Prolog和SQL等。Prolog语言是一种基于逻辑的编程语言,适用于问题求解和智能推理等领域。
智能机器人的发展面临着一些挑战。智能机器人的成本仍然较高,限制了其在大规模应用中的普及。智能机器人的安全性和隐私保护需要得到更好的保障。智能机器人的能力还有很大的提升空间,需要不断进行技术创新和研发。
4. 声明式编程语言
SCRATCH智能机器人是一种创新的教育工具,它通过结合编程与机器人技术,帮助孩子们培养逻辑思维和解决问题的能力。它具有简单直观的可视化编程语言、与实际机器人行为相结合的特点,并且具有广阔的市场前景和未来发展方向。相信在不久的将来,SCRATCH智能机器人将在教育领域发挥越来越重要的作用。
第三部分:SCRATCH智能机器人的优势和创新
第二部分:SCRATCH智能机器人的应用领域
面向对象编程语言是智能机器人编程领域中常用的一类语言。其特点是通过将数据和相关的操作封装在一起,形成对象,从而实现对现实世界中对象的抽象和模拟。常见的面向对象编程语言有Python、Java和C++等。Python语言具有简洁、易读的特点,适合初学者使用,并且在机器学习和人工智能领域有广泛的应用。
智能机器人的前景依然十分广阔。随着人工智能技术的不断发展,智能机器人将会越来越强大和智能化。它们将会进一步深入到各个行业和领域,为人们的生活和工作带来更多的便利和创新。
随着人工智能技术的迅速发展,智能机器人已经成为一个备受关注的领域。据统计数据显示,全球智能机器人市场规模在不断扩大,预计到2025年将达到5000亿美元。智能机器人成为了多个行业的热门研究和应用方向。
第四部分:SCRATCH智能机器人的市场前景
1. 面向对象编程语言
智能机器人在家庭生活中也有着重要的作用。它们可以扮演家庭助理的角色,为人们提供养老护理、健康监测、智能家居等服务。智能机器人可以根据人们的需求和习惯,自动调节室内温度、播放喜欢的音乐等,提供便捷的生活体验。智能机器人还可以通过语音交互和人们进行互动,增加家庭的乐趣和娱乐性。
随着信息技术的快速发展和教育改革的需求,SCRATCH智能机器人市场前景广阔。据统计,全球教育机器人市场规模预计将在未来几年内保持较高的增长率,其中SCRATCH智能机器人将占据重要地位。随着编程教育的普及和机器人技术的推广,SCRATCH智能机器人也将迎来更大的市场需求和发展空间。
五、智能机器人的挑战与前景
正文:
与传统的编程教学相比,SCRATCH智能机器人有着许多优势和创新之处。它采用可视化编程语言,使编程更加简单直观,降低了学习难度,让更多的学生能够轻松上手。SCRATCH智能机器人能够将抽象的编程概念与实际的机器人行为相结合,帮助学生们更好地理解编程原理和应用。SCRATCH智能机器人还可以与其他教学资源结合,例如教科书、多媒体教材等,提供更为全面和多样化的学习体验。
2. 函数式编程语言
编程SCRATCH智能机器人
第一部分:什么是SCRATCH智能机器人
SCRATCH智能机器人是一种基于编程语言SCRATCH的教育工具,它结合了编程和机器人技术,可以让孩子们通过编写代码来控制机器人的行为。SCRATCH智能机器人通常由机器人主体、传感器和蓝牙模块组成,可以实现诸如避障、跟随线路、跳舞等各种动作。通过与SCRATCH编程软件的结合,孩子们可以通过可视化编程语言来控制机器人的行为,培养他们的逻辑思维和解决问题的能力。
二、智能机器人在工业领域的应用
智能机器人在医疗领域也有着广阔的应用前景。它们可以帮助医生进行手术,提高手术精准度和安全性。智能机器人还可以用于病房巡视、病历整理等工作,减轻了医护人员的工作负担,提高了医疗服务的效率和质量。随着人口老龄化问题的日益严重,智能机器人在医疗领域的应用将会越来越重要。
3. 脚本语言
函数式编程语言是另一种常见的智能机器人编程语言类别。函数式编程语言强调函数的定义和使用,以及避免可变状态和副作用。这种编程风格使得代码可读性高,易于维护和调试。常见的函数式编程语言有Haskell和LISP等。Haskell语言具有强大的类型系统和高阶函数的支持,非常适合用于进行高级算法的实现。
第六部分:总结